Waiting for the App Store will not get you to ten
Early on, the App Store algorithm has no reason to surface you. No installs means no ranking, and no ranking means no installs. You cannot break that loop by waiting. You break it by going and getting your first users by hand, and the best place to find them is stores that just launched.
Why new stores are the ideal first users
A store that opened this week is setting up its stack from scratch. It has gaps everywhere and no loyalty to any existing app. That is the opposite of an established store that already solved its problems. New founders will actually reply, actually try things, and actually tell you what they think, which is exactly what you need in the early days.
The play for your first users
- Find new Shopify stores the same day they launch, filtered to the niche your app serves.
- Read what is already on the store so you can tailor the pitch.
- Reach out founder to founder with something honest: you just launched, I built this to solve X, would love your feedback.
- Talk to enough of them and you will not just get installs, you will get the early feedback that makes the product better.
Why personalized beats broad
When you have zero users, one real conversation is worth more than a thousand impressions. Reaching a fresh founder with a specific, human message converts, and it teaches you who your app is really for.
